  may 9 th , 2012 automotive grade AUIPS2051l/auips2052g www.irf.com 1 intelligent power low side switch features ? over temperature shutdown ? over current shutdown ? active clamp ? low current & logic level input ? esd protection ? optimized turn on/off for emi ? diagnostic on the input current applications ? solenoids and relays ? 24v tr uck loads description the au ips2051l/auips2052g is a three terminal intelligent power switch (ips) that features a low side mosfet with over - current, over - temperature, esd protection and drain to source active clamp. the auips2052 is a dual channel device while the AUIPS2051 is a single channel.this device offers protections and the high reliability required in harsh environments. the switch provides efficient protection by turning off the power mosfet when the temperature exceeds 165c or when the drain cu rrent reaches 1.8a . the device restarts once the input is cycled. a serial resistance connected to the input provides the diagnostic. the avalanche capability is significantly enhanced by the active clamp and covers most inductive load demagnetizations. p roduct summary rds(on) 300m ?
